vue开发是什么软件
-
Vue开发并不是指一个特定的软件,而是指使用Vue.js框架进行前端开发。Vue.js是一种用于构建用户界面的渐进式JavaScript框架。它通过将视图层和数据层进行分离,实现了更高效的前端开发。
Vue.js具有以下特点:
- 渐进式框架:Vue.js可以逐步采用,使您可以将其应用于现有项目中的一部分,而无需重写整个项目。
- 轻量级:Vue.js文件的大小相对较小,加载速度较快。
- 简单易学:Vue.js使用简单的模板语法,使开发者能够快速上手。
- 双向数据绑定:Vue.js采用了响应式数据绑定机制,当数据改变时,视图自动更新;当视图改变时,数据也会相应更新。
- 组件化开发:Vue.js将页面拆分成多个可复用的组件,使代码更易于维护和复用。
- 生态丰富:Vue.js拥有广泛的插件和第三方库,可以方便地与其他库和框架进行集成。
与Vue.js配套使用的工具包括Vue CLI、Vue Router和Vuex等。Vue CLI是Vue.js官方提供的脚手架工具,可以帮助开发者快速搭建Vue.js项目。Vue Router用于管理前端路由,实现单页应用的页面跳转和导航。Vuex是Vue.js的状态管理库,用于管理应用的状态。
总而言之,Vue开发并不是指一个特定的软件,而是指使用Vue.js框架进行前端开发,通过Vue.js及其相关工具可以帮助开发者快速构建高效、灵活的前端应用。
2年前 -
Vue是一种用于构建用户界面的渐进式JavaScript框架,也是一款开源前端框架。它使用了MVVM(Model-View-ViewModel)的架构模式,通过数据绑定和组件化的方式,使开发者能够更高效地构建交互性的Web应用程序。
Vue具有以下特点:
-
简单易用:Vue提供了简洁的API和易于理解的语法,使开发者能够更快速地上手和开发。它采用了声明式的语法,可以更直观地描述应用程序的状态和行为。
-
组件化开发:Vue将应用程序划分为多个组件,每个组件对应一个特定的功能和界面。开发者可以通过组合这些组件来构建整个应用程序,提高了代码的可复用性和可维护性。
-
响应式数据绑定:Vue使用了响应式数据绑定机制,当数据发生变化时,界面会自动更新。开发者无需手动操作DOM,减少了开发工作量和出错的可能性。
-
虚拟DOM:Vue使用虚拟DOM技术来提高渲染性能。它会在内存中构建一个虚拟的DOM树,通过对比新旧虚拟DOM树的差异,只更新需要变更的部分,减少了对实际DOM的操作,提高了渲染效率。
-
生态系统丰富:Vue拥有一个庞大的生态系统,有大量的第三方插件和库可供使用。开发者可以根据实际需求来选择和集成这些插件,提高开发效率。
总结起来,Vue是一款简单、灵活、高效的前端框架,适用于构建各种类型的Web应用程序。无论是小型项目还是大型项目,都可以通过Vue来实现快速和可靠的开发。
2年前 -
-
Vue.js是一个用于构建用户界面的渐进式JavaScript框架。它是一个开源项目,由一位前Google工程师尤雨溪创建,并由全球的开发者社区进行维护和推进。
Vue.js的设计目标是简单易用,能够快速构建高效的web应用程序。它采用了响应式数据绑定和组件化的开发模式,使开发者能够以声明式的方式编写代码,实现自动渲染和维护UI界面。
Vue.js具有以下特点:
- 渐进式开发:Vue.js可以逐步应用到现有项目中,也可以从零开始构建一个全新的应用程序。
- 轻量级框架:Vue.js的核心库只有20kb左右,对于移动端和低带宽环境非常友好。
- 强大的模块化:Vue.js支持封装和组合组件,使得代码复用变得更加简单,提高项目的可维护性。
- 良好的生态系统:Vue.js提供了丰富的插件和扩展,可以与其他工具和库无缝集成,方便灵活地构建应用。
- 容易上手:Vue.js的API和文档清晰易懂,学习曲线很平缓,即使是对于初学者来说也能快速上手。
开发一个Vue.js应用的流程一般包括以下几个步骤:
- 安装Vue.js: 首先需要在项目中安装Vue.js。可以通过npm或者CDN来引入Vue.js。
- 创建Vue实例:使用Vue构造函数创建一个Vue实例,并将其挂载到一个HTML元素上,以便于Vue管理该元素及其子元素。
- 数据绑定:使用Vue的模板语法来绑定数据到HTML模板中,实现页面的数据动态显示。
- 事件绑定:添加事件处理函数,通过v-on指令来绑定DOM元素的事件,并在Vue实例的methods选项中实现对应的事件处理函数。
- 组件化开发:将页面划分为多个组件,每个组件负责一部分UI和逻辑,使用Vue的组件系统来管理组件之间的通信和交互。
- 路由管理:使用Vue的路由插件来实现单页面应用的页面切换和导航管理。
- 状态管理:使用Vuex插件来管理应用的状态,实现不同组件之间的数据共享和状态同步。
- 打包部署:使用Webpack等工具将Vue应用进行打包压缩,并部署到生产环境中。
通过以上步骤,开发者可以使用Vue.js来构建出高效、可维护、可扩展的web应用程序。
2年前